Key Words: Fujita exponent; Liouville type theorem; Higher-order parabolic inequalities; Test function method
Abstract: This paper deals with a coupled system of fourth-order parabolic inequalities |u|(t) >= -Delta(2)u + |v|(q), |v|(t) >= -Delta(2)v + |u|(p) in S = R-n x R+ with p, q > 1, n >= 1. A Fujita-Liouville type theorem is established that the inequality system does not admit nontrivial nonnegative global solutions on S whenever n/4 <= max(p+1/pq-1, q+1/pq-1). Since the general maximum-comparison principle does not hold for the fourth-order problem, the authors use the test function method to get the global non-existence of nontrivial solutions.
